    You measure from the bumpstop to the bottom of frame.

    There's different measurements for the different way the saddle is attached to the axle, but my manual is from 1996 so maybe they were all the same by 2000.
    On mine I get slightly different measurements at each so I average it out.

    my experience is the air bags should be low as possible for the best ride. not too low where the back end is lower than the front or there is a vibration from the bags being too low. if my air bags are about 1/2 way aired up the truck bounces like crazy, let some air out & the ride is so much more better. have to plat around to get it just where I like it.

    You should be able to go as low as 2 3/8 without any driveline issues. Easiest way is make a cardboard template,I think measurement is at left front bump stop.
